> Yes you need a wireless access point, I recommend the lynksys.
> If you get the
> 4 port model, you can get rid of the hub if you want to.  Then
> you only need
> a wireless adapter for your daughters machine.  USB is easy to setup.  I
> use one to
> connect machines I work on to the internet for updates.

        Actually you do not NEED an access point, you can use two "normal" wireless
cards in ad-hoc mode which allows them to communicate directly with each
other. However, contrary to what I said I recommend getting an access point.
The reason is I tried to go the "ad-hoc" route and it was VERY difficult to
get going, to save time I just bought an AP. TTYL
